test: env: Add test for environment storage in SPI NOR

Add test for environment stored in SPI NOR. The test works in a very
similar way to the current test for environment stored in ext4 FS,
except it generates spi.bin file backing the SPI NOR.

def mk_env_spi_flash(state_test_env):
"""Create an empty SPI NOR image."""
c = state_test_env.ubman
filename = 'spi.bin'
persistent = c.config.persistent_data_dir + '/' + filename
spi_flash_img = c.config.source_dir + '/' + filename
if os.path.exists(persistent):
c.log.action('SPI NOR image file ' + persistent + ' already exists')
else:
try:
utils.run_and_log(c, 'dd if=/dev/zero of=%s bs=1M count=2' % persistent)
except CalledProcessError:
call('rm -f %s' % persistent, shell=True)
raise
utils.run_and_log(c, ['cp', '-f', persistent, spi_flash_img])
return spi_flash_img

@pytest.mark.boardspec('sandbox')
@pytest.mark.buildconfigspec('cmd_echo')
@pytest.mark.buildconfigspec('cmd_nvedit_info')
@pytest.mark.buildconfigspec('cmd_nvedit_load')
@pytest.mark.buildconfigspec('cmd_nvedit_select')
@pytest.mark.buildconfigspec('env_is_in_spi_flash')
def test_env_spi_flash(state_test_env):
"""Test ENV in SPI NOR on sandbox."""
c = state_test_env.ubman
spi_flash_img = ''
try:
spi_flash_img = mk_env_spi_flash(state_test_env)
# force env location: SF
response = c.run_command('env select SPIFlash')
assert 'Select Environment on SPIFlash: OK' in response
response = c.run_command('env save')
assert 'Saving Environment to SPIFlash' in response
response = c.run_command('env load')
assert 'Loading Environment from SPIFlash... OK' in response
response = c.run_command('env info')
assert 'env_valid = valid' in response
assert 'env_ready = true' in response
assert 'env_use_default = false' in response
response = c.run_command('env info -p -d')
assert 'Environment was loaded from persistent storage' in response
assert 'Environment can be persisted' in response
response = c.run_command('env info -d -q')
assert response == ""
response = c.run_command('echo $?')
assert response == "1"
response = c.run_command('env info -p -q')
assert response == ""
response = c.run_command('echo $?')
assert response == "0"
response = c.run_command('env erase')
assert 'OK' in response
response = c.run_command('env load')
assert 'Loading Environment from SPIFlash... ' in response
assert 'bad CRC, using default environment' in response
response = c.run_command('env info')
assert 'env_valid = invalid' in response
assert 'env_ready = true' in response
assert 'env_use_default = true' in response
response = c.run_command('env info -p -d')
assert 'Default environment is used' in response
assert 'Environment can be persisted' in response
# restore env location: NOWHERE (prio 0 in sandbox)
response = c.run_command('env select nowhere')
assert 'Select Environment on nowhere: OK' in response
response = c.run_command('env load')
assert 'Loading Environment from nowhere... OK' in response
response = c.run_command('env info')
assert 'env_valid = invalid' in response
assert 'env_ready = true' in response
assert 'env_use_default = true' in response
response = c.run_command('env info -p -d')
assert 'Default environment is used' in response
assert 'Environment cannot be persisted' in response
finally:
if spi_flash_img:
call('rm -f %s' % spi_flash_img, shell=True)
